I made these gingerbread cookie blocks (Lori Holt pattern from Vintage Christmas book) for my daughter and I to decorate during the Christmas holiday. The last few years I have fallen in love with making a small batch of gingerbread cookies at holiday time. We made the patterns for the dress and bow tie ourselves and I used craft felt for them. I used the plaid fabric for the boys because I fell in love with the fabric at the store and had to try it.
Here are dear daughter's blocks. Mine are the same except my buttons are different. |
